Walking
If you are starting from the Elko Convention Center, head south on Idaho Street. Continue walking straight for about 0.5 miles. You will pass by a few shops and local eateries. Sherman Station Visitor's Center is located at 1405 Idaho St, on your right side. Look for a building with a large sign indicating the Visitor's Center.
Public Bus
Begin your journey at the nearest bus stop for the Elko Transit service. Take the bus route that heads towards downtown Elko. Get off at the stop closest to the intersection of Idaho Street and 14th Street. From there, walk south along Idaho Street for about 0.3 miles. You will see Sherman Station Visitor's Center on your left at 1405 Idaho St.
Bicycle
If you have access to a bicycle, start from the Elko City Park. Ride east on 12th Street until you reach Idaho Street. Turn right (south) onto Idaho Street and continue for about 1 mile. Sherman Station Visitor's Center will be on your right at 1405 Idaho St. Be cautious of traffic as you ride.
